Her Story

About Mamie

I've been in consulting for 12 years, which has been an eye-opening journey that allows me to walk in my purpose while developing personally. I previously worked in HR and as a marketing director before transitioning to consulting. My business was originally called Integra Machine Lifestyle and Consulting, but we rebranded to Flourish Lifestyle and Consulting. I get to merge my HR background and my marketing and branding background to really focus on the people - I love the people and helping them flourish in life and be themselves, maximizing themselves without leaving themselves on the table. We take a holistic approach to leadership development, branding, and people work, changing the culture of companies through conflict management and strategy. It all comes back down to really developing the whole person and developing the people inside the organization to flourish. I work with award-winning authors and consultants, helping them pivot and align their programs with where they're going. One of my most notable achievements was working with an award-winning author, taking her $50 monthly program and turning it into an annual Arts Festival that was recognized here in Columbus, Ohio, and now she goes on tour, making more impact while changing her ROI.

Her Interview

Ten minutes with Mamie

01What do you attribute your success to?

I would say my resilience, but also my children. I have a very creative household, and watching them be who they are, they inspire me. But also just understanding my resilience in life has pushed me beyond any struggle that I have ever been through. They have pushed me to say, even when things are hard, 'Okay, this is just me walking out my testimony.' And I say this to myself often - that's me walking out my testimony. And that has pushed me. That has gave me a greater push.

02What’s the best career advice you’ve ever received?

The best career advice that I ever received is that a lot of times we look at failure as this major downfall thing, but looking at it as it all works together for our good. So, even failure pushes us to our success, and it has taught me to not stay down often. Go ahead and process what you need to process, but get back up faster than you can. Take the lessons and run with it.

03What advice would you give to young women entering your industry?

One thing that I would really give them is to really get clear on you, because everything else flows from you. Your mindset, your wealth, your relationships, they all flow from you. So if you get really clear on who you are, your identity, and what you stand for, your strengths, and even those little weaknesses - they work for our good too, right? So really understanding who you are, and taking that, and maximizing that, and showing up fully in that, I would say that would be my biggest advice.

04What are the biggest challenges or opportunities in your field right now?

I would say some of the opportunities, just as a minority woman, is really finding opportunities, right? Getting yourself out into those spaces, and what spaces is for me? How to build a network. Sometimes that can be complicating. But I recognize stepping outside the box and connecting with others is really what helps with that.

05What values are most important to you in your work and personal life?

Integrity is number one for me. Having integrity in all things that I do, and with integrity that is also authenticity - showing up authentically in my business so that those that I am called to serve, I'll be able to serve. I would also say excellence. I'm a recovering perfectionist, so I have learned that everything doesn't have to be perfect, but if I operate in my best self, that I'm operating in excellence, and the people who receive from me, they get to experience that excellence through me. So it's no longer the pressure of being perfect and getting stuck in perfect.
